通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

怎么搭建开发团队

怎么搭建开发团队

搭建开发团队的基本步骤包括确定团队目标和责任、招聘合适的人才、建立有效的沟通和协作机制、实施团队培训和发展计划以及评估和调整团队结构和效能。其中,招聘合适的人才是构建开发团队的关键步骤,需要根据团队的目标和责任,确定需要的技能和能力,然后通过各种渠道寻找和筛选合适的人才。这一步需要投入大量时间和精力,但是它决定了团队的基本素质和潜力,对团队的长期发展起到决定性的作用。

一、确定团队目标和责任

首先,你需要明确你的开发团队将承担哪些任务和责任。这可能包括软件开发、系统维护、技术支持等各种职责。你需要根据公司的业务需求和战略目标,确定团队的主要目标和工作重点。

二、招聘合适的人才

在明确团队目标和责任后,你需要根据这些目标和责任,确定你的团队需要哪些技能和能力。这可能包括编程语言、软件开发方法、项目管理技能等。然后,你需要通过各种渠道,如招聘网站、社交媒体、校园招聘等,寻找和筛选合适的人才。在招聘过程中,你需要对候选人进行全面的评估,包括他们的技术能力、团队协作能力、学习能力等。

三、建立有效的沟通和协作机制

一个高效的开发团队需要有良好的沟通和协作机制。你需要建立定期的团队会议,让团队成员可以交流信息、讨论问题、分享经验。此外,你还需要建立有效的项目管理工具,如任务跟踪系统、代码库等,帮助团队成员协作完成任务。

四、实施团队培训和发展计划

为了保持团队的竞争力,你需要定期对团队成员进行培训和发展。这可能包括技术培训、团队建设活动、职业发展规划等。通过培训和发展,你可以提升团队成员的技术能力,增强团队的凝聚力,帮助团队成员实现职业发展。

五、评估和调整团队结构和效能

最后,你需要定期评估你的团队的结构和效能,看看是否需要进行调整。你可能需要增加或减少团队成员,调整团队的角色和责任,改变工作方法和流程等。通过评估和调整,你可以确保你的团队能够适应业务需求的变化,持续提高效能。

相关问答FAQs:

1. 我应该从哪些方面考虑来搭建一个高效的开发团队?
在搭建一个高效的开发团队时,您可以从以下几个方面进行考虑:

  • 了解团队成员的技能和专长,以便合理分配任务和项目。
  • 建立透明的沟通渠道,确保团队成员之间能够顺畅地交流和协作。
  • 提供良好的工作环境和必要的工具,以帮助团队成员更好地完成工作。
  • 鼓励团队成员的学习和成长,提供培训和发展机会。
  • 建立有效的项目管理和跟踪机制,确保项目按时交付。

2. 如何吸引和留住优秀的开发人员加入我的团队?
吸引和留住优秀的开发人员是搭建一个高效开发团队的关键。您可以考虑以下几点:

  • 提供具有竞争力的薪酬和福利待遇,吸引优秀的开发人员加入团队。
  • 提供良好的工作环境和发展机会,让开发人员感到有成长空间和发展潜力。
  • 建立良好的团队文化和氛围,让开发人员感到归属感和满足感。
  • 重视工作与生活的平衡,给予开发人员合理的工作时间和休假政策。
  • 提供有挑战性和有意义的项目,让开发人员感到兴趣和动力。

3. 如何管理一个跨地域的开发团队?
管理一个跨地域的开发团队需要特别注意以下几点:

  • 建立有效的沟通渠道,使用在线协作工具和视频会议等方式,确保团队成员之间能够实时交流和协作。
  • 确定清晰的工作时间和工作方式,避免时差和文化差异对团队的影响。
  • 建立有效的项目管理和跟踪机制,确保项目进度的可控性和可见性。
  • 建立跨地域团队的文化和价值观,让团队成员感到归属感和团队凝聚力。
  • 定期组织团队聚会或团建活动,增进团队成员之间的了解和信任。
相关文章